    TensionIQ is a cargo safety intelligence company focused on bringing real-time visibility, securement-state awareness, and predictive risk detection to cargo securement operations. The transportation industry has spent decades creating visibility into vehicles, drivers, routes, and fleet operations, yet cargo itself remains largely unmanaged once a load begins moving. TensionIQ was founded on the belief that cargo securement is the next major opportunity for operational intelligence, safety improvement, and risk reduction. TensionIQ is developing technology designed to monitor cargo securement conditions, evaluate Working Load Limit (WLL) status, identify securement-state changes, and provide actionable intelligence before cargo-related incidents occur. The vision extends beyond traditional monitoring to the creation of a new layer of cargo intelligence capable of supporting safety, compliance, operational decision-making, and future predictive analytics. TensionIQ is currently advancing through development and industry engagement with transportation stakeholders, fleet operators, technology providers, insurers, and government agencies. Initial development efforts are focused on commercial trucking, where cargo securement requirements, operational complexity, and safety considerations create a strong foundation for validation and deployment. Long term, the underlying intellectual property and technology architecture are intended to support broader applications across rail, maritime, aviation, defense, intermodal transportation, and supply chain operations.
